When I worked at Raytheon, we hired an AN-124 from Volga-Dnieper to carry a bunch of Patriot ground equipment to Riyadh. This was a Russian company, I believe, but the reference to Dnieper was to associate it with Ukraine. The Antonov design bureau was located in Ukraine. The freight charge New Hampshire to Riyadh was one million clams. I don’t think there was any other commercial means of transporting. The equipment was insured for one-million bucks, and arrived without incident.
